Can you swap them?

Scale the mixture, or accept a flatter cake. 23 × 33 cm / 9 × 13 in has 25.8% more area, so a 20 × 30 cm traybake mixture poured straight in sits 79% as deep. It still bakes, and it browns more at the edges for being shallower. Multiplying by 1.26 restores the depth the recipe was written for.

Multiply every ingredient, including the eggs — round to the nearest half egg and adjust the liquid rather than rounding a whole one up.

Baking time

A mixture 79% as deep is done earlier, not cooler. Leave the temperature alone, start testing at about 79% of the stated time, and let the skewer decide. Why depth sets the time and diameter barely does →

Frequently asked questions

Can I use a 20 × 30 cm traybake instead of a 23 × 33 cm / 9 × 13 in?

Yes, with the mixture multiplied by 0.79. 20 × 30 cm traybake has 600 cm² of base against 754.8 cm², so an unscaled 23 × 33 cm / 9 × 13 in recipe sits 126% as deep and bakes faster.

What is the difference between a 23 × 33 cm / 9 × 13 in and a 20 × 30 cm traybake?

23 × 33 cm / 9 × 13 in has a base area of 754.8 cm² and 20 × 30 cm traybake has 600 cm² — 23 × 33 cm / 9 × 13 in is 25.8% larger. At their usual depths they hold 3.77 L and 2.7 L.

Do I need to change the baking time between a 23 × 33 cm / 9 × 13 in and a 20 × 30 cm traybake?

Yes. Moving a 20 × 30 cm traybake mixture into 23 × 33 cm / 9 × 13 in makes it 79% as deep, so start checking at about 79% of the stated time. Depth drives baking time far more than tin diameter does.
